📜 All Formula data fields for Chuan Bei Zhi Ke Syrup
📜 Names
Pinyin Name
Chuan Bei Zhi Ke Tang Jiang
中文名 (Chinese)
川贝止咳糖浆
English Name
Chuan Bei Zhi Ke Syrup
💊 Form & Use
Type (类别)
解表药
Category
Chinese patent medicines
Dosage Form
糖浆剂 (Syrup)
Administration
Oral
Source / 出处
ETCM
🌿 Composition
Herbs (中文)
前胡, 川贝母, 桔梗, 款冬花, 甘草, 紫苏叶, 紫菀, 苦杏仁, 陈皮
Herbs (Pinyin)
Qian Hu, Chuan Bei Mu, Jie Geng, Kuan Dong Hua, Gan Cao, Zi Su Ye, Zi Wan, Ku Xing Ren, Chen Pi
🩺 Syndromes & Indications
Syndromes (中文)
风寒袭肺证
Syndromes (English)
Syndrome of wind-cold assailing the lung
Indications (中文)
咳嗽
Indications (English)
Cough
